Austin Street Bistro is a charming restaurant located in the historic downtown district of Port Jefferson. It serves made-to-order soups, sandwiches, and salads in a warm and attentive atmosphere. The menu offers a variety of delectable options, including a chicken salad sandwich, grilled cheese, turkey/ham roll-up, and the incredible Marti Gra sandwich. The bruschetta, French onion soup, and cream of curried peanut soup are extremely fresh and delicious. The Crostini with herb mozzarella and the egg salad with skillet potatoes are also highly recommended. The atmosphere is intimate and very clean, with quick service. It’s the perfect lunch or dinner spot to enjoy a nice meal. The restaurant has a cozy, bistro vibe, reminiscent of Paris, with purple linen tablecloths and live plants by the windows. Customers enjoy the friendly service, with the owner being very hands-on and caring. The bread served is hearty and delicious, often soaked in honey, vanilla, or maple, and served warm. The salads are fresh and flavorful, with dark greens, tomatoes, and vegetables in a tasty vinaigrette. Main dishes like the ribeye steak are cooked perfectly, tender, and sizable, often leaving guests with leftovers to enjoy later. The bread pudding is a standout dessert, widely praised as the best on the planet. The restaurant also offers complimentary bread covered in maple butter and oatmeal cookies for dessert. Overall, Austin Street Bistro provides an excellent dining experience with great food, warm atmosphere, and attentive service, making it a must-visit spot for both lunch and dinner.
